I get mine from Elizabeth Teglund @ Crucible in NC. The stuff ships from other areas, but she handles the orders for the southeast more or less. Be sure to ask for the GDA stuff, it is already surface ground. the HRA stuff is only descaled.

On 12/13/06 I paid $64.81 for a 1/8"x11/2"x36" bar of CPM154 from Crucible. This was ordered with some D2 and another size CPM154. I wonder if there was a price increase Jan.1
 
I ordered some CPM 154 just last week from Crucible. I got two bars at 3/32~1/4 by 1 1/2" by 36 for 101 including shipping. Remember that there is a $70 minimum order through crucible.

Zac
 
FYI, the piece that I bought from Pops is not precision ground. That explains why my price wasn't nearly as high; you pay a pretty high premium for the precision ground stuff.
 
I bought a piece of Crucible 154 CM 5/32" X 1 1/2" X 3' from Pop for around $45. You have to call him though to see that he has it. He carries a good supply of Crucible steel. Hatachi is been a real PIA to buy from.
